How to File a Medical Malpractice Case

A malpractice situation occurs when a medical professional fails in their duty to treat a patient in accordance with accepted standards of care. For instance when an orthopedic surgeon commits a mistake during surgery that results in injury to nerves in the femoral region, this could be considered medical negligence.

Duty of care

All medical professionals are held to an obligation to provide care arising from the doctor-patient relationship. This includes taking reasonable steps to avoid injury or treat a patient's illness. The doctor must inform the patient about any risks associated with a treatment or procedure. If a doctor fails to inform the patient about dangers that are known to the profession could be liable for malpractice.

A medical professional who fails to meet their duty of caring is liable for negligence and must compensate a plaintiff. To prove this aspect of the case, it has to be shown that a defendant's actions or lack of action were not in accordance with the standards that other medical professionals would have followed under similar circumstances. This is usually proven by expert testimony.

A medical professional who is familiar with the relevant practices and types tests that should be used to diagnose an illness could testify the defendant's actions were against the standard of care. They can also explain in simple terms to a juror the reason the standard was not met.

Not all medical professionals are qualified to handle the malpractice cases, therefore an experienced attorney must know how to locate and work with the right experts. In cases that are complex the expert might be required to provide detailed reports as well as be present to testify in court.

Breach of duty

Determining the standard of care and showing that the medical professional violated it is the premise of all malpractice law firms cases. This is typically done through expert testimony from other doctors who have similar skills, knowledge and experience as the alleged negligent doctor.

The norm of care is basically what other medical professionals in your situation would offer to treat you. Doctors have a responsibility to their patients of care to behave reasonably and with due caution when treating a patient. The duty of care extends to their loved ones. But this doesn't mean that medical professionals are required to be good Samaritans in and outside of the hospital.

If a medical professional does not fulfill their duty of care and you're injured, they are accountable for your injuries. The plaintiff must also prove that the breach directly caused their injury. If, for example, the defendant surgeon is not reading the chart of their patient and operates on the wrong leg, causing injury, this is likely negligence.

It is important to remember that it is possible to prove the source of your injury. For example in the event that the surgical sponge was left behind following a gallbladder surgery, it's hard to demonstrate that the patient's issues resulted directly from the surgery.

Causation

A doctor is only liable for malpractice if the patient can prove that the doctor's negligence caused the injury. This is referred to as "causation." It is crucial to understand that a negative outcome of an operation does not necessarily constitute medical malpractice. The plaintiff must prove that the doctor did not adhere to the standard of care that is normally followed in similar cases.

It is the doctor's responsibility to inform the patient of the risks and potential outcomes of a procedure, including its success rate. If a patient has not been adequately informed about risks, they could choose to defer the procedure in favor of a different option. This is called the duty of informed consent.

The legal system's structure to handle medical malpractice law firms cases grew out of the 19th century English common law, and it is regulated by court decisions and legislative statutes which differ between states.

To pursue a doctor for a lawsuit, you must file an official complaint or summons to a state's court. The document outlines the alleged wrongs, and seeks compensation for harms caused by the physician's actions. The attorney representing the plaintiff needs to schedule a deposition for the defendant doctor under oath, which is an opportunity for the plaintiff to present evidence. The deposition is usually recorded for use as evidence during the trial of the case.

Damages

A patient who believes that a doctor has acted negligently in medical treatment can file a lawsuit in court. A plaintiff must establish the following four elements to be able to establish a valid claim of malpractice: a legal duty to perform the duties of practice in the field; a breach of this obligation; an injury resulting by the breach; and damages that are reasonable in relation to the injury.

Expert testimony is required in medical malpractice cases. The attorney of the defendant will engage in discovery, where the parties demand written interrogatories, or requests for production of documents. These are queries and requests for evidence that the opposing party must respond under oath. The process can be a lengthy and drawn out one, and attorneys from both sides will bring experts to be witnesses.

The plaintiff must also show that negligence has caused substantial damages. It is expensive to pursue a malpractice claim. If the damages are small and the case is not a big one, it may not be worth the effort to bring an action. The amount of the damages must also exceed the cost to file the lawsuit. Therefore, it is essential for patients to speak with an experienced Board Certified legal malpractice attorney before filing a lawsuit. After a trial is concluded either the winning or losing party may appeal the decision of a lower court. In the event of an appeal the higher court will review the record and determine whether the lower court committed any errors in the law or in fact.
